ILL ( Interlibrary Loan) The Interlibrary Loan Service gives SWOSU students, faculty, and staff a fast, convenient way to obtain materials that are not available in the Al Harris Library. You can make interlibrary loan requests by filling out an online interlibrary loan form for journal and magazine articles or for books, videos, and sound recordings Document Delivery
